The sniff sound is an auditory cue often used in literature to convey a wide range of emotions and physical states. It is produced by the inhalation of air through the nose, often associated with emotions such as sadness, disdain, or illness. In text, the sniff sound can be described through dialogue tags, narrative descriptions, or sound effects, each serving a different purpose in the storytelling process.

Beyond its literal function, the sniff sound can carry symbolic meanings, influencing readers' perceptions of characters and situations. For instance, a sniff can symbolize disapproval or superiority, subtly shaping the dynamics of a scene.

Understanding the sniff sound involves recognizing its dual role as both a literal and symbolic element within a narrative. Literally, it can indicate a character's response to external stimuli such as cold or allergies. Symbolically, it can suggest underlying emotions or social cues, providing depth to character interactions and plot developments.
